Land is a natural resource, an economic driver, and a social asset. As a natural resource, it must be preserved to sustain life. As an economic driver, it is one of the primary types of real estate. As a social asset, it helps determine quality of life. Given the importance of land to the present and future condition of human beings, it is imperative that it is carefully and strategically managed. This course explores aspects of land management including land-use planning, land acquisition, land development, and land investments as well as land brokerage. It is divided into four main topics: Land Management, Land Brokerage, Operating a Land Brokerage, and Land Investment.
